Job Description

As a Corporate Legal Counsel, you will be part of the global Legal team, providing day-to-day legal support to designated business units and corporate functions.

In this position, you will provide legal counseling regarding corporate and commercial matters and other tasks typically entrusted to in-house counsel in similar roles. You will work in close collaboration with senior legal leadership and cross-functional business teams.

In addition, you may support selected corporate initiatives, including Business Development, Sustainability, and other cross-company projects.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following:

Commercial contract drafting and negotiation, including with strategic customers, resellers, and distributors.

Supporting the development and implementation of compliance mechanisms and processes in the areas of anti-corruption, antitrust, data security, export control, privacy compliance, and other regulatory requirements.

Supporting internal training efforts regarding corporate compliance policies.

Reviewing and negotiating business development agreements, including alliances, cooperation agreements, joint development agreements, investments, and M&A-related agreements (in collaboration with senior legal leadership).

Assisting on additional legal matters and contributing to the overall legal function.

Working with and coordinating local outside counsel, as needed.

Serving as a regular interface with legal and business teams across regions.

Handling other responsibilities customarily assigned to in-house corporate counsel.

Essential Education, Skills and Experience:

  • Must possess a BA from an accredited law school and be licensed to practice in Israel; MBA is an advantage.
  • 6+ years of progressively complex experience in compliance, commercial, and transactional law.
  • Previous experience supporting compliance projects and matters is a strong advantage.
  • Minimum of 2 years' experience working as in-house counsel for a US or other publicly traded company.
  • Must be an English native level speaker.
  • Excellent business counseling, drafting, and negotiating skills.
  • Highly motivated with good organizational skills and the ability to multi-task.
  • Professional maturity and the ability to collaborate effectively to resolve issues.
  • Good analytical and reasoning skills, with the ability to communicate practical and innovative legal solutions.
  • Experience working in a complex and high-pressured international business environment.
  • Strong PC and commun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and adapt to change.

Travel requirement: 10%
